Subject: On-call handover — stale-cache postmortem

Hi Maren,

Handing over the Lanternfish postmortem draft. The stale-cache bug traced back to the invalidation hook in the Quillbox layer skipping keys with trailing slashes; I've annotated the offending diff and added a regression test in the review branch. Please double-check the TTL math in section 3 before approving. If anything in the timeline looks off, reach out directly.

escalation mailbox, fafof-bahip: tamael@ordincorp.test

Keep
# `suggest.max_results` at or below 8 to avoid UI jitter, and set
# `suggest.debounce_ms` to at least 150 for slow links. Plugins
# must never cache raw gazetteer rows client-side; cache only the
# rendered suggestion strings. The widget backend resolves entries
# against the gazetteer database, reached via the connection
# string below.

replica DSN, kajep-yahag: mssql://praok_svc:iF@db-8d68.plorvaio.local:5432/eliion

**Ticket: Digest scheduler double-sends on DST boundary**

For the weekly eng sync: the Quillbatch digest scheduler fired twice for all subscribers in regions crossing the autumn clock change. The window calculation uses wall-clock time, so the repeated 02:00 hour produced duplicate batches. Proposed fix: switch scheduling to UTC offsets with a dedupe key per window. Affected run counts are attached. The regression was introduced in the build identified by the trace token below.

trace token, kawip-fafog: htk14_26e64c4d35154e